Dell EMC PowerEdge R750xs Rack Mount Server
As one of the first Gen3 Xeon Scalable servers to market, Dell EMC’s PowerEdge R750 set a very high standard and impressed us mightily when we exclusively reviewed it at its launch. It packs a truly remarkable specification into its 2U of rack height and offers a huge expansion potential as well.
The only issue with the R750 is it could be overkill for businesses that have more modest rack server requirements, as they could end up paying for features their workloads may never use. Not everyone needs core-heavy Xeon Scalable Platinum CPUs, a massive 8TB of system memory, Intel PMEM 200 modules or liquid-cooling, after all.
Enter the PowerEdge R750xs, which is designed for businesses that don’t need such a high-end specification, taking a lot of the goodness from the R750 and offering it as a more cost-optimised version. Along with large server scale-out projects, the R750xs targets more general customer workloads such as databases, virtualization, VDI and cloud services.
Dell EMC PowerEdge R750xs specifications (as reviewed)
Chassis 2U rack
CPU 2 x 20-core 2.3GHz Intel Xeon Scalable Silver 4316
Memory 512GB 2,667MHz ECC DDR4
Storage bays 8 x hot-swap SFF (max. 26 with rear bay)
RAID Dell PERC H755 front SAS
Storage included 5 x 960GB SAS3 SSDs
Other Storage Dell BOSS-S2 with 2 x 480GB M.2 SATA SSDs
Network 2 x Gigabit LOM, Intel X710 10GbE 2P SFP+ OCP 3
Expansion 6 x PCI-E 4 slots, 1 x OCP 3 edge slot
Power 2 x 1,400W Platinum hot-plug PSUs
Management Dell iDRAC9 Enterprise
Warranty 3Yr Standard On-Site NBD
